fix(overlay): allow clients to receive actual key events

We were consuming key events and committing the text of the key
directly, which breaks clients that expect or require actual key events.

Instead, we still consume the key event (to prevent key repeat during
long-press timer), but we send a synthetic key press and release to the
client that matches the key that was pressed.
